WebDec 31, 2016 · 4. Animal Protein and Phosphorus. Animal protein contains high levels of phosphorus. And when we consume high amounts of phosphorus, one of the ways our bodies normalize the level of phosphorus is with a hormone called fibroblast growth factor 23 (FGF23). WebA range of animal foods in the diet provide protein and are important sources of vitamins and minerals in the UK diet. Fish and shellfish Fish provides protein as well as B vitamins, potassium and many types are a source of iodine. Shellfish such as prawns, crab and mussels contain selenium, zinc and copper and some types also provide iodine.
